South West Water fined over sewage discharge
South West Water was ordered to pay £7,500 in fines and costs after sewage escaped from an Exeter sewage treatment works into the River Exe. The case was brought by the Environment Agency.Countess Wear is one of the largest sewage treatment works in Devon. It treats sewage from Exeter and surrounding villages.On October 21, 2005 […]

New study sheds light on stillwater barbel
Although the barbel has evolved as a river fish, there has been a growing trend towards stocking them into stillwater fisheries.Whilst this has split opinions among fishery interests, the Environment Agency’s view is that some stillwaters are suitable for the fish to thrive. Water quality is the key factor, but it is difficult to determine […]
